How to Rank #1 on Google: A Step-by-Step SEO Blueprint

Ranking #1 on Google is the ultimate goal for businesses, bloggers, and marketers alike. Achieving the top position in search results can lead to increased visibility, traffic, and revenue. However, securing this coveted spot requires a well-structured and data-driven SEO strategy. In this step-by-step SEO blueprint, we will walk you through the essential tactics to rank #1 on Google.


1. Understand Google’s Ranking Factors


Google uses over 200 ranking factors to determine the position of web pages. While it’s impossible to optimize for all, focusing on the most critical ones can significantly boost your rankings:

  • Relevance and Quality of Content – Google prioritizes content that is informative, well-written, and valuable to users.
  • Backlinks – High-quality backlinks from authoritative websites signal trust and credibility.
  • Page Experience – Google considers mobile-friendliness, page speed, and security (HTTPS) for ranking.
  • User Engagement – Metrics like dwell time, bounce rate, and click-through rate (CTR) influence rankings.
  • On-Page SEO – Title tags, meta descriptions, headers, and structured data impact search engine visibility.

2. Perform Keyword Research


Keyword research is the foundation of a successful SEO strategy. Here’s how to do it effectively:


  • Use Keyword Research Tools – Leverage tools like Google Keyword Planner, Ahrefs, or SEMrush to find high-traffic, low-competition keywords.
  • Analyze Competitor Keywords – Identify which keywords your competitors rank for and target gaps they haven’t optimized.
  • Focus on Long-Tail Keywords – These keywords have lower competition and attract highly targeted traffic.
  • Understand Search Intent – Ensure your content aligns with what users are looking for, whether it’s informational, navigational, or transactional.

3. Optimize Your Content for SEO


Once you have your target keywords, it’s time to optimize your content to rank higher in search results.


a) Craft Engaging and Valuable Content


  • Write in-depth, comprehensive articles that answer users’ questions.
  • Use clear headings (H1, H2, H3) to improve readability.
  • Include bullet points, numbered lists, and images to enhance engagement.

b) Optimize On-Page SEO

  • Title Tag: Include your target keyword within the first 60 characters.
  • Meta Description: Write a compelling summary that encourages users to click.
  • URL Structure: Use short, descriptive URLs with keywords (e.g., yoursite.com/rank-1-google-seo).
  • Image Optimization: Compress images and use alt text with keywords.

4. Improve Technical SEO


Technical SEO ensures that search engines can crawl and index your site efficiently.

  • Increase Site Speed – Use Google PageSpeed Insights to identify and fix speed issues.
  • Mobile Optimization – Ensure your website is responsive and works seamlessly on all devices.
  • Secure Your Site (HTTPS) – Install an SSL certificate to protect user data.
  • Fix Broken Links – Use tools like Screaming Frog to identify and repair broken links.
  • Implement Structured Data – Use Schema Markup to help Google understand your content better.

5. Build High-Quality Backlinks

Backlinks are one of Google’s strongest ranking signals. Here’s how to build them effectively:

  • Guest Blogging – Write guest posts for reputable websites in your industry.
  • Broken Link Building – Find broken links on authoritative sites and offer your content as a replacement.
  • Skyscraper Technique – Create better content than existing top-ranking pages and reach out to sites linking to them.
  • Engage in Digital PR – Get featured in news articles, interviews, and industry reports.

6. Optimize for User Experience (UX)

Google prioritizes websites that offer a seamless user experience. Improve your site’s UX by:

  • Enhancing navigation and internal linking for easy access to content.
  • Reducing pop-ups and intrusive ads.
  • Ensuring fast load times and responsive design.

7. Leverage Local SEO (For Local Businesses)


If you have a local business, optimizing for local SEO can help you rank #1 in local search results.

  • Claim Your Google My Business Listing – Ensure your profile is complete and up to date.
  • Get Positive Reviews – Encourage satisfied customers to leave Google reviews.
  • Optimize for Local Keywords – Use location-based keywords (e.g., “best coffee shop in New York”).
  • Build Local Citations – List your business in local directories like Yelp and Yellow Pages.

8. Monitor, Analyze, and Adjust


SEO is an ongoing process. Regularly monitor your rankings and adjust your strategy accordingly.

  • Use Google Analytics and Google Search Console – Track traffic, keyword rankings, and site performance.
  • Check for Algorithm Updates – Stay updated with Google’s latest changes to avoid penalties.
  • Continuously Update Content – Refresh outdated content and optimize underperforming pages.


Ranking #1 on Google requires patience, consistency, and a well-structured SEO approach. By implementing these steps—keyword research, on-page optimization, technical SEO, link building, UX improvements, and local SEO—you can improve your chances of securing the top spot. Keep analyzing and refining your strategies, and over time, you’ll see significant growth in your rankings and organic traffic.


Are you ready to take your website to the top of Google? Start implementing these strategies today and watch your rankings soar!

Table of Contents

Categories
Recent Comments
    Picture of Uzzal Kapat
    Uzzal Kapat
    Professional SEO, SMM, Ads, SMO, and YouTube Expert to Build a Strong Presence on Search Engines and Social Platforms.
    SHARE THIS ARTICLE:
    Facebook
    Twitter
    LinkedIn

    Want a Free Digital Marketing Strategy Customized to Your Business?

    Enter your email to get strategic insights, a plan of action, and pricing options.